Quarterly Planning Note — Board of Directors

Renegotiation of the Fenwick Yard lease has entered its second round. Landlord Corvell Estates proposed a nine-year term with stepped escalations; our counter seeks a five-year term plus a break clause. Tomas Ebrey estimates annualized savings near eight percent if accepted. Facilities has modeled relocation alternatives as leverage. The confidential rationale for our position follows below.

internal memo for kafop-haduf: Headcount on the Ralix team goes from 9 to 140 by the end of April. Gross margin on Ralix came in at 5 percent against a plan of 5 percent.

Handover for new starters — Misa to Tobren. We share Lab 3 with the Orvane sensors team. Book bench time on the wall sheet, label everything, and clear your station by 17:30. Fume hood is theirs on Tuesdays. The connecting door from our corridor stays locked; open it with the shared code below.

badge for haduf-bafop: bdg-O-78

**Mgmt Meeting Minutes — Retiring the Brightline Range**

Quick recap for sales leads at Fenholt Supplies: we agreed to retire the Brightline fixture range by year-end. Remaining stock moves to clearance pricing next month, and accounts on standing orders get migrated to the Lumetta range. Trade-in incentives were approved in principle. The confidential note on next steps sits just below.

board note of bajof-bajeg: The pricing group signed off on a budget of $13.4 million for Project Sildor. The renewal with Lamixek Holdings closes at $48.9 million a year, 49 percent above the last contract.